STATES PATENT OFFICE COMBINED CARD BOX AND FOLDING 'CANASTA TRAY OR SIlVIILAR ARTICLE To all whom it may concern:
Be it known that I, Charles F. Degner, a citizen of the United States, residing at Boonville, county of Cooper, State of Missouri, have invented a new, original, and ornamental Design for a Combined Card Box and Folding Canasta Tray or Similar Article, of which the following is a specification, reference being made to the accompanying drawings, forming a part hereof.
In the drawings:
Fig. 1 is a plan view of a combined card box and folding canasta tray, showing my new design in opened position;
Fig. 2 is an end elevational view thereof in opened position;
Fig. 3 is a plan view of the top of the box in closed position;
Fig. 4 is a front elevation view of the box in closed position;
Fig. 5 is an end elevation view of the box in closed position, looking at the right end in Fig. 4;
Fig. 6 is an end elevational view of the box in closed position looking at the left end in Fig. 4;
Fig. 7 is a rear elevational view of the box in closed position, looking at the back in Fig. 4; and' Fig. 8 is a front elevational view thereof in opened position, looking at the right end in Fig. 2.
The dominant features of my new design are shown in solid lines in the drawing.
I claim:
The ornamental design for a combined card box and folding canasta tray or similar article, as shown and described.
CHARLES F. DEGNER.
